About this role
Here at The Exploration Company, we are developing, producing, and operating Nyx, a modular and reusable space orbital vehicle that can eventually be refuelled in orbit and that can carry cargo - and potentially humans in the longer run.
We are looking for a hands-on and rigorous AIT Test Technician to support the preparation, integration, execution, and reporting of environmental and functional test activities for spacecraft sub-systems and hardware.
This role is critical to ensuring that all testing activities are executed safely, accurately, and according to procedures and quality standards. The ideal candidate is meticulous, structured, technically skilled, and comfortable operating in a fast-paced aerospace development environment.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
ENVIRONMENTAL TEST PREPARATION & EXECUTION
- Support the setup, integration, and execution of environmental tests including:
- Vibration testing
- Shock testing
- Thermal Vacuum (TVAC) testing
- Ancillary testing activities
- Prepare hardware, tooling, instrumentation, and Ground Support Equipment (GSE) for test campaigns.
- Install thermocouples, accelerometers, harnessing, and instrumentation according to test procedures and engineering requirements.
- Operate environmental test equipment including vibration shaker, shock test facility, TVAC facility, and associated monitoring systems.
- Perform pre-test and post-test inspections of test setups.
- Support testing activities both internally and at external test facilities.
PROCEDURES, DOCUMENTATION & REPORTING
- Prepare and execute test procedures with adherence to safety, cleanliness, and quality standards.
- Ensure all operations are properly documented and traceable.
- Report, anomalies, and observations during operations.
- Verify that tools, instrumentation, and measurement equipment comply with calibration requirements before use.
TOOLING, EQUIPMENT & FACILITY SUPPORT
- Maintain and organize tooling, sensors, adapters, cables, and test equipment.
- Monitor the condition and calibration status of test assets and measurement equipment.
- Perform first-level maintenance and troubleshooting on test equipment and support systems.
- Support the integration and validation of new tooling and test setups.
- Assist engineers in defining and improving test processes, setups, and operational workflows.
- Ensure laboratory and test areas remain organized, safe, and operationally ready.
